1.下載Process Explorer 2.打開Process Explorer,查看CPU使用情況最高的進程 3.雙擊該進程,查看詳情 \ 4. 獲取cpu使用最好的線程tid 5. 查詢sql_id [sql] view ...
解決此問題的關鍵在於如何找到造成CPU使用率過高的SQL語句。步驟如下: 使用Process Explorer工具查看到Oracle進程,雙擊Oracle進程,在彈出的屬性窗口的Threads選項卡中查看占用CPU較高的線程號 TID 。 在PL SQL工具中執行以下SQL語句: 根據sql id獲取對應的Sql語句 sql text,sql fulltext select from v sqla ...
2017-03-07 17:20 1 2886 推薦指數:
1.下載Process Explorer 2.打開Process Explorer,查看CPU使用情況最高的進程 3.雙擊該進程,查看詳情 \ 4. 獲取cpu使用最好的線程tid 5. 查詢sql_id [sql] view ...
CPU過高的sql語句 7.查詢sid和serial# 8.殺掉進程 ...
1、查看系統CPU負載及使用率的命令為:top vmstat top 命令:查看進程級別的cpu使用情況。 vmstat 命令:查看系統級別的cpu使用情況。 下面通過具體的圖例來分析: 1.1 top 命令可以查看進程的CPU、內存等資源 ...
前幾天遇到的一個問題,自己本地用VM配置的虛擬機,一般會top查看進程以及CPU占用的一些情況。又一次用laravel 打印對象,里面的內容比較多,瀏覽器當時就卡了。 然后看進程的情況。我以為會是nginx和php-fpm 這兩個一半一半這樣子的情況,結果發現 kswapd0 這個進程 ...
服務器跑大量高負載程序,會造成cpu soft lockup。 解決辦法: #追加到配置文件中 echo 30 > /proc/sys/kernel/watchdog_thresh #查看 [root@git-node1 data]# tail -1 /proc/sys ...
一、問題描述 運行在Windows上的Oracle開發庫的oracle進程CPU使用率保持在99%,服務器和數據庫均反應緩慢。 二、排查思路 可能造成CPU使用率高的情況有:大量排序、大量SQL解析、全表掃描、Oracle Bug等。因此希望找到占用CPU較高的進程ID(UNIX ...
kubelet CPU 使用率過高問題排查 問題背景 客戶的k8s集群環境,發現所有的worker節點的kubelet進程的CPU使用率長時間占用過高,通過pidstat可以看到CPU使用率高達100%。針對此問題對kubelet進程的異常進行問題排查。 集群環境 ...
有很多, 1、有時候應用的負載大了,CPU自然會受業務請求的增加和增高; 2、有時候因為GC回收使用了過高的CPU ...